Forecast: Import of Dobbies, Jacquards for Spinning Machines and Looms to the US

The US import of dobbies and jacquards for spinning machines and looms is projected to decrease steadily from 2024 to 2028, starting from approximately 2.376 million USD and declining to about 0.892 million USD. In 2023, the import value was comparatively higher, indicating a shrinking demand or a shift in market dynamics. Year-on-year, the percentage decrease is noticeable, with a compounded annual growth rate (CAGR) demonstrating a consistent drop over the five-year period.
